Well this year I decided to finally make a Halloween wreath and absolutely love it!



Made from cupcake liners and contact paper.
I used a hot glue gun for the cupcake liners and let the glue pull after each one to make it look like cobwebs.
then I cut out bats, glued them onto skewers, and stuck them into the wreath.
(This way I can reuse the white for other holidays.)
